Bob now has his article out - I suggest reading it https://hailstatebeat.wordpress.com/2015/08/04/under-new-scheme-chris-jones-aiming-for-breakout-junior-campaign/

I think this paragraph is telling:
He’s got reason to believe he will, too, as a new scheme under new defensive coordinator Manny Diaz ought to showcase Jones’ immense talents. To hear the 6’6” behemoth explain it, the defense last year had the defensive line setting things up for the linebackers to make plays. The plan under Diaz, Jones says, is for the defensive linemen to be the ones making those big plays as the scheme puts he and his teammates in one-on-one situations with an opportunity to get in the backfield quickly.
